About Emma Wright
Material development consultant with over 12+ years experience combining textile design with material engineering. Working with global brands, start ups and textile accelerators, specialising in bridging the gap between manufacturers and brands along with generating communications between brands and their consumers. I believe a collective of minds and skills, a cross collaboration between academia and design, will accelerate innovative material developments that sit alongside planet and user centered thinking.Still passionate about print and textile design, hand painting and drawing will always sit alongside my material consultancy studio.

Freelance Textile Developer & Designer
CurrentRecent clients : Burberry, Jigsaw, Mira Mikati, Mary Katrantzou and Odyssee.This was a multi skilled print and textile design and development role for small projects or long term seasonal collections. My main expertise was in design and development, working closely with designers to create original textile pieces for the brand's demographic. My experience from working with suppliers from Italy, France and China allows me to reassuringly follow sampling and provide technical support especially with jacquard design in particular. Production is also apart of my skill set providing knowledge in cost consumptions and quality control throughout the process.

E-Textile Designer
Researching and developing the use of e-textiles in KnitRegen’s medical products with the view to improving stroke rehabilitation. This collaborative role brought the electrical engineering and textile design areas of the business together - problem solving, market researching and developing e-textile integrated software, aiming to produce seamless integration of their technology within their knit products.
Textile Researcher
This research focused role of Versarien and the Royal College of Art, explored stimuli - responsive textiles with graphene. My main role is exploring and testing various print applications, material bases and print designs that optimise Versariens products. Working within a small research team, bringing together software, screen printing, sustainable thinking and design development skills and presenting our findings to the Versarien team and their external stakeholders.
Print Designer (Haute Couture)
On joining Ralph & Russo I established their first print and textile department. My role consisted of working directly with the creative director to produce creative and original designs that worked within the brands DNA and specific clientele demographic. My design versatility spanned over the couture, accessories, clients and the new RTW collection, creating a variety of prints, jacquards and screen print based designs within a small textile team that I managed.My skill set is vast from using various software and hand drawing mediums to co-ordinating a small team to work between the design studio and our in house atelier were the couture pieces are made. A key part to my role was production and quality control as well as developing new bridges between ourselves and quality suppliers to source the luxury fabrics we required.
Print Production Co-Ordinator And Designer
At Peter Pilotto I had two key roles; first was designing the prints and jacquards using various design techniques and mediums to fabricate the creative directors vision. My second role was to manage the print team in co-ordinating the print production for all the print/jacquard looks, turning the samples into cost efficient artworks for the production pipeline. This would include adjusting technicalities for aesthetic purposes, colour calibrating and working fabric consumptions as well as acquiring strong communication skills between the production team in order to fit within tight deadlines and budgets.
Print Designer
Creator of prints for Versace womenswear mainline, Atelier and scarf collections. Overseeing the full design process from concept building, designs to technical placements and artworks for production. I also translated my artowrks into technical for fur, lavorazione and fabric embellishments as well as working on specialist projects including celebrities and product design i.e the Disaronno Versace special edition bottle in 2014.
